In most cases, the Brown Recluse you’ll find in Windsor Heights, IA isn’t very large. Usually, the brown recluse measures between 0.5–1 inch in size. It can be identified by its characteristic brown color and the marking running down its back. Many describe that this stripe resembles the shape of a fiddle, which is why the brown recluse is often called the brown fiddler.
